The Drishyam Conclusion trailer reunites Ajay Devgn and Tabu for a final battle, while Jaideep Ahlawat enters as a new investigator threatening Vijay Salgaonkar.

MUMBAI: The Drishyam Conclusion trailer has arrived, bringing Ajay Devgn and Tabu back into one of Hindi cinema’s most recognisable battles of wits as Vijay Salgaonkar prepares to protect his family one final time.

Released on September 9, the trailer shows Vijay facing renewed pressure over the case that has followed the Salgaonkar family throughout the franchise. Tabu returns as Meera Deshmukh, while Shriya Saran reprises her role as Vijay’s wife, Nandini.

This time, however, Vijay faces a new opponent.

Who joins Ajay Devgn and Tabu?

Jaideep Ahlawat joins the franchise as SP Crime Branch Rajveer Singh Tomar, an investigator who appears determined to uncover the truth behind the long-running case.

The Drishyam Conclusion trailer suggests Rajveer will bring a different approach to the investigation, putting Vijay’s carefully constructed defence under fresh pressure.

Prakash Raj also joins the Hindi film as a lawyer, adding another major figure to the confrontation. Rajat Kapoor, Ishita Dutta, Mrunal Jadhav and Kamlesh Sawant are among the returning cast members.

Ahlawat has clarified that his character is new and is not a replacement for Akshaye Khanna’s character from the previous film.

What does the trailer reveal?

The central conflict remains familiar, but the stakes appear higher.

Vijay has spent years protecting his family and staying ahead of investigators. Meera, meanwhile, remains determined to uncover what happened to her son.

The new trailer presents that confrontation as the final stage of their story, while Rajveer’s arrival creates another challenge for Vijay.

Importantly, the Hindi film is not simply following the recently released Malayalam Drishyam 3. Ajay Devgn said at the trailer launch that Drishyam: The Conclusion has a different story from the Malayalam film starring Mohanlal.

When will Drishyam: The Conclusion release?

The film will arrive in cinemas on October 2, 2026, continuing the franchise’s long association with the date.

Directed by Abhishek Pathak, the film is presented by Star Studio18 and produced by Panorama Studios. Pathak also contributes to the story and screenplay.

The Drishyam Conclusion trailer positions the movie as the final chapter of Vijay Salgaonkar’s Hindi-language story, raising the biggest question for fans: can Vijay stay ahead of everyone once again, or has his carefully constructed plan finally reached its limit?

With Devgn and Tabu returning and Ahlawat entering the investigation, the finale has a familiar rivalry alongside a significant new threat.
